diff options
author | Abodunrinwa Toki <toki@google.com> | 2015-05-29 16:43:14 +0100 |
---|---|---|
committer | Abodunrinwa Toki <toki@google.com> | 2015-06-01 14:02:54 +0100 |
commit | 925843d535e0bf72a54c3597d42acb51539c877f (patch) | |
tree | 596574e379dcf38fabcdb36d65c135fae50f87e1 /core/res/res/layout | |
parent | 3b7f9615b70c7e62a018eb1abf0a52c8ba3e4d27 (diff) | |
download | frameworks_base-925843d535e0bf72a54c3597d42acb51539c877f.zip frameworks_base-925843d535e0bf72a54c3597d42acb51539c877f.tar.gz frameworks_base-925843d535e0bf72a54c3597d42acb51539c877f.tar.bz2 |
More FloatingToolbar styles.
-Font type is now "Medium"
-Adds 2dp rounded corners
-Fix paddings and alignments
Bug: 21372498
Bug: 21177954
Change-Id: Ib3e754dc9539386e3f3c0c773c65eca75d4eed80
Diffstat (limited to 'core/res/res/layout')
-rw-r--r-- | core/res/res/layout/floating_popup_close_overflow_button.xml | 1 | ||||
-rw-r--r-- | core/res/res/layout/floating_popup_container.xml | 2 | ||||
-rw-r--r-- | core/res/res/layout/floating_popup_menu_button.xml | 3 | ||||
-rw-r--r-- | core/res/res/layout/floating_popup_menu_image_button.xml | 12 | ||||
-rw-r--r-- | core/res/res/layout/floating_popup_open_overflow_button.xml | 4 | ||||
-rw-r--r-- | core/res/res/layout/floating_popup_overflow_image_list_item.xml | 14 | ||||
-rw-r--r-- | core/res/res/layout/floating_popup_overflow_list_item.xml (renamed from core/res/res/layout/floating_popup_overflow_list_item) | 5 |
7 files changed, 28 insertions, 13 deletions
diff --git a/core/res/res/layout/floating_popup_close_overflow_button.xml b/core/res/res/layout/floating_popup_close_overflow_button.xml index a1d2811..0dbf7f7 100644 --- a/core/res/res/layout/floating_popup_close_overflow_button.xml +++ b/core/res/res/layout/floating_popup_close_overflow_button.xml @@ -1,3 +1,4 @@ +<?xml version="1.0" encoding="utf-8"?> <!-- /* Copyright 2015, The Android Open Source Project ** diff --git a/core/res/res/layout/floating_popup_container.xml b/core/res/res/layout/floating_popup_container.xml index c2b4ccc..f37aee1 100644 --- a/core/res/res/layout/floating_popup_container.xml +++ b/core/res/res/layout/floating_popup_container.xml @@ -24,4 +24,4 @@ android:elevation="2dp" android:focusable="true" android:focusableInTouchMode="true" - android:background="?attr/colorBackgroundFloating"/> + android:background="@drawable/floating_popup_background"/> diff --git a/core/res/res/layout/floating_popup_menu_button.xml b/core/res/res/layout/floating_popup_menu_button.xml index 23ae7f0..b549198 100644 --- a/core/res/res/layout/floating_popup_menu_button.xml +++ b/core/res/res/layout/floating_popup_menu_button.xml @@ -24,9 +24,10 @@ android:paddingTop="0dp" android:paddingBottom="0dp" android:layout_margin="0dp" + android:gravity="center" android:singleLine="true" android:ellipsize="end" - android:fontFamily="sans-serif" + android:fontFamily="sans-serif-medium" android:textSize="@dimen/floating_toolbar_text_size" android:textAllCaps="true" android:textColor="?attr/colorForeground" diff --git a/core/res/res/layout/floating_popup_menu_image_button.xml b/core/res/res/layout/floating_popup_menu_image_button.xml index 5934136..07eb7a3 100644 --- a/core/res/res/layout/floating_popup_menu_image_button.xml +++ b/core/res/res/layout/floating_popup_menu_image_button.xml @@ -16,17 +16,21 @@ */ --> <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android" - android:layout_width="@dimen/floating_toolbar_menu_button_minimum_width" - android:layout_height="@dimen/floating_toolbar_height" - android:minWidth="@dimen/floating_toolbar_menu_button_minimum_width" + android:layout_width="wrap_content" + android:layout_height="wrap_content" + android:minWidth="@dimen/floating_toolbar_menu_image_button_width" android:minHeight="@dimen/floating_toolbar_height" android:focusable="false" android:focusableInTouchMode="false" android:importantForAccessibility="no"> <ImageButton android:id="@+id/floating_toolbar_menu_item_image_button" - android:layout_width="@dimen/floating_toolbar_menu_button_minimum_width" + android:layout_width="@dimen/floating_toolbar_menu_image_button_width" android:layout_height="@dimen/floating_toolbar_height" + android:paddingStart="@dimen/floating_toolbar_menu_button_side_padding" + android:paddingTop="@dimen/floating_toolbar_menu_image_button_vertical_padding" + android:paddingEnd="@dimen/floating_toolbar_menu_button_side_padding" + android:paddingBottom="@dimen/floating_toolbar_menu_image_button_vertical_padding" android:scaleType="centerInside" android:background="?attr/selectableItemBackground" /> </LinearLayout> diff --git a/core/res/res/layout/floating_popup_open_overflow_button.xml b/core/res/res/layout/floating_popup_open_overflow_button.xml index dca5384..3027565 100644 --- a/core/res/res/layout/floating_popup_open_overflow_button.xml +++ b/core/res/res/layout/floating_popup_open_overflow_button.xml @@ -20,6 +20,10 @@ android:layout_height="match_parent" android:minWidth="@dimen/floating_toolbar_menu_button_minimum_width" android:minHeight="@dimen/floating_toolbar_height" + android:paddingStart="0dp" + android:paddingTop="0dp" + android:paddingBottom="0dp" + android:paddingEnd="4dp" android:src="@drawable/ic_menu_moreoverflow_material" android:contentDescription="@string/floating_toolbar_open_overflow_description" android:background="?attr/selectableItemBackgroundBorderless" /> diff --git a/core/res/res/layout/floating_popup_overflow_image_list_item.xml b/core/res/res/layout/floating_popup_overflow_image_list_item.xml index 9988ad5..fc04b31 100644 --- a/core/res/res/layout/floating_popup_overflow_image_list_item.xml +++ b/core/res/res/layout/floating_popup_overflow_image_list_item.xml @@ -16,17 +16,21 @@ */ --> <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android" - android:layout_width="@dimen/floating_toolbar_menu_button_minimum_width" - android:layout_height="@dimen/floating_toolbar_height" - android:minWidth="@dimen/floating_toolbar_menu_button_minimum_width" + android:layout_width="wrap_content" + android:layout_height="wrap_content" + android:minWidth="@dimen/floating_toolbar_overflow_image_button_width" android:minHeight="@dimen/floating_toolbar_height" android:focusable="false" android:focusableInTouchMode="false" android:importantForAccessibility="no"> <ImageView android:id="@+id/floating_toolbar_menu_item_image_button" - android:layout_width="@dimen/floating_toolbar_menu_button_minimum_width" + android:layout_width="@dimen/floating_toolbar_overflow_image_button_width" android:layout_height="@dimen/floating_toolbar_height" - android:layout_marginStart="18dp" + android:paddingTop="@dimen/floating_toolbar_menu_image_button_vertical_padding" + android:paddingStart="@dimen/floating_toolbar_overflow_side_padding" + android:paddingBottom="@dimen/floating_toolbar_menu_image_button_vertical_padding" + android:paddingEnd="@dimen/floating_toolbar_overflow_side_padding" + android:layout_margin="0dp" android:scaleType="centerInside"/> </LinearLayout> diff --git a/core/res/res/layout/floating_popup_overflow_list_item b/core/res/res/layout/floating_popup_overflow_list_item.xml index 59a6d7e..2ff45bb 100644 --- a/core/res/res/layout/floating_popup_overflow_list_item +++ b/core/res/res/layout/floating_popup_overflow_list_item.xml @@ -19,7 +19,7 @@ android:layout_width="match_parent" android:layout_height="wrap_content" android:textAppearance="?android:attr/textAppearanceListItemSmall" - android:gravity="center_vertical" + android:gravity="start|center_vertical" android:minWidth="@dimen/floating_toolbar_menu_button_side_padding" android:minHeight="@dimen/floating_toolbar_height" android:paddingStart="@dimen/floating_toolbar_overflow_side_padding" @@ -29,7 +29,8 @@ android:layout_margin="0dp" android:singleLine="true" android:ellipsize="end" - android:fontFamily="sans-serif" + android:fontFamily="sans-serif-medium" android:textSize="@dimen/floating_toolbar_text_size" android:textColor="?attr/colorForeground" android:textAllCaps="true" /> + |